For the 2011 Mercedes-Benz E350, it's generally recommended to change the Transmission Fluid every 40,000 to 60,000 miles, although this can vary based on driving conditions and usage. It's important to consult the owner's manual for specific guidelines and recommendations. Regular checks for fluid condition and level are also advisable to ensure optimal transmission performance. If you notice any signs of slipping or unusual noises, it's best to have it inspected sooner.

How many quarts of oil does a 2011 Mercedes E350 take?

The 2011 Mercedes E350 typically requires about 8.5 quarts of engine oil when using a new oil filter. It's important to check the owner's manual for the specific oil capacity and recommendations for oil type. Always ensure to verify the level after filling to avoid overfilling.


When you get your oil changed are they changing your transmission oil?

No, they are not. If you ask for an oil change they will change the engine oil & filter. They will not change the transmission fluid unless you ask for it.


What does B13 code on 2011 pilot mean?

B= Change Oil & Filter1= Rotate Tires 3=Change Transmission Fluid
